Museo Carlo Bilotti Hotels
Popular Hotels near Museo Carlo Bilotti
More hotels near Museo Carlo Bilotti-
PIAZZA AUGUSTO IMPERATORE 10, Rome, 186, IT Show mapBvlgari Hotel Roma
With a stay at Bvlgari Hotel Roma, you'll be centrally located in Rome, just a 3-minute walk from Via del Corso and 8 minutes by foot from Spanish Steps. ... Read more…
0.9 kmFree WifiFrom USD 3148per room / per night -
Via Vittorio Veneto 125, Rome, 00187, IT Show mapThe Westin Excelsior, Rome
With a stay at The Westin Excelsior, Rome, you'll be centrally located in Rome, steps from Via Veneto and 10 minutes by foot from Spanish Steps. This... Read more…
4/5Good641 reviews0.8 kmFree WifiFrom USD 549per room / per night -
Via Vittorio Veneto 72, Rome, 187, IT Show mapBaglioni Hotel Regina - The Leading Hotels of the World
With a stay at Baglioni Hotel Regina - The Leading Hotels of the World, you'll be centrally located in Rome, within a 10-minute walk of Spanish Steps and... Read more…
4.5/5Excellent296 reviews0.9 kmFree WifiFrom USD 651per room / per night -
Piazza Trinita Dei Monti 6, Rome, 00187, IT Show mapHassler Roma
A stay at Hassler Roma places you in the heart of Rome, steps from Spanish Steps and Piazza di Spagna. This luxury hotel is 0.5 mi (0.7 km) from Trevi... Read more…
4.6/5Excellent100 reviews0.8 kmFree WifiFrom USD 2222per room / per night -
Via Gerolamo Frescobaldi 5, Rome, 198, IT Show mapParco dei Principi Grand Hotel & SPA - Preferred Hotels & Resorts
With a stay at Parco dei Principi Grand Hotel & SPA - Preferred Hotels & Resorts, you'll be centrally located in Rome, within a 5-minute drive of Spanish... Read more…
4.4/5Good650 reviews0.9 kmFree WifiFrom USD 429per room / per night -
Via Vittorio Veneto 70, Rome, 187, IT Show mapGrand Hotel Palace
With a stay at Grand Hotel Palace, you'll be centrally located in Rome, steps from Via Veneto and 10 minutes by foot from Spanish Steps. This luxury hotel... Read more…
4.3/5Good869 reviews0.9 kmFree WifiFrom USD 390per room / per night -
Via del Vantaggio 14, Rome, 186, IT Show mapThe First Arte - Preferred Hotels & Resorts
With a stay at The First Arte - Preferred Hotels & Resorts, you'll be centrally located in Rome, steps from Via del Corso and 10 minutes by foot from... Read more…
4.7/5Excellent420 reviews0.8 kmFree WifiFrom USD 864per room / per night -
26/36 Via Liguria, Rome, 187, IT Show mapW Rome
With a stay at W Rome, you'll be centrally located in Rome, steps from Via Veneto and 9 minutes by foot from Spanish Steps. This luxury hotel is 0.5 mi... Read more…
4.5/5Excellent2 reviews0.9 kmFree WifiFrom USD 658per room / per night